From Wikipedia: An F-Zero jazz album was released on March 25, 1992 in Japan by Tokuma Japan Communications.[2][29] It features twelve songs from the game on a single disc composed by Yumiko Kanki and Naoto Ishida, and arranged by Robert Hill and Michiko Hill. The album also features Marc Russo (saxophones) of the Yellowjackets and Robben Ford (electric guitar).[2]
